Nanotechnology Engineering Technicians
SOC: 17-3029.12 · Job Zone 3 (Medium preparation)
Operate commercial-scale production equipment to produce, test, or modify materials, devices, or systems of molecular or macromolecular composition. Work under the supervision of engineering staff.
Task Breakdown
19 tasks analyzed
Operate nanotechnology compounding, testing, processing, or production equipment in accordance with appropriate standard operating procedures, good manufacturing practices, hazardous material restrictions, or health and safety requirements.
Maintain work area according to cleanroom or other processing standards.
Repair nanotechnology processing or testing equipment or submit work orders for equipment repair.
Measure or mix chemicals or compounds in accordance with detailed instructions or formulas.
Monitor equipment during operation to ensure adherence to specifications for characteristics such as pressure, temperature, or flow.
Calibrate nanotechnology equipment, such as weighing, testing, or production equipment.
Record nanotechnology test results in logs, laboratory notebooks, or spreadsheet software.
Assist nanoscientists, engineers, or technologists in processing or characterizing materials according to physical or chemical properties.
Produce detailed images or measurement of objects, using tools such as scanning tunneling microscopes or oscilloscopes.
Inspect nanotechnology work products to ensure quality or adherence to specifications.
Perform functional tests of nano-enhanced assemblies, components, or systems, using equipment such as torque gauges or conductivity meters.
Maintain accurate record or batch-record documentation of nanoproduction.
Set up or execute nanoparticle experiments according to detailed instructions.
Assist nanoscientists, engineers, or technologists in writing process specifications or documentation.
Compile information or prepare reports on nanotechnology experiments or applications.
Measure or report toxicity of engineered nanoparticles.
Assemble components, using techniques such as interference fitting, solvent bonding, adhesive bonding, heat sealing, or ultrasonic welding.
Measure emission of nanodust or nanoparticles during nanocomposite or other nano-scale production processes, using systems such as aerosol detection systems.
Test nano-enabled products to determine amount of shedding or loss of nanoparticles.
